Step 1: Choosing the Right Topic
For most students is picking a subject. It is important to select a topic that will save them months of time. The topic you choose should be:
relevant to the course: Make sure it's in line with your course syllabus and the core concepts.
Feasible Find a subject that you are able to complete in the timeframe and resources available.
Interesting It's a subject that will take you weeks researching it, so pick something that will keep your interest.
If you're in the process of pursuing MCOM for example, subjects such as "Impact of Digital Payments on Consumer Behavior" or "Role of Microfinance in Rural Development" can be applied and research-able.

Step 2: Understanding the Guidelines
Each IGNOU project has its own guidelines, which include the word count, formatting and submission rules. Missing even one detail can affect your evaluation. Start by downloading the official project guide for your class from IGNOU's website. IGNOU website. Key points to focus on:
"Word count generally between 3000 - 5000 words according to the course.
Formatting: Use clear headings, subheadings as well as appropriate page numbers.
Referencing properly cite all sources; IGNOU likes APA rather than Harvard style.
Formula for Submission Most courses require a printed copy along with one that is soft on a pen drive or CD.
It is a typical reason projects are delayed or even rejected.
Step 3: Conducting Research
Once you've got a topic then the next step is researching. Research is the foundation of every project. Without solid information and facts your project may feel lacking.
Where do I begin:
Materials for studying and reading Start in the right direction with IGNOU textbooks and reference materials recommended in your syllabus.
Articles and online journals Websites like Google Scholar, ResearchGate, and JSTOR can give credible research.
Interviews and surveys For practical courses gathering data of the primary respondents adds value as well as originality.
While conducting research, keep an simple notebook or digital file with key points and references. It makes it easier to write later.
Step 4: Structuring Your Project
One of the most common mistakes student makes is to dive straight into writing without having a plan. An organized structure keeps your writing organized and clear. This is a general structure which can be used in most courses:
Title Page Incorporates your name (or name), enrollment date, course, and the title of your project.
Acknowledgment Acknowledgement: Thank your instructor fellow students, coworkers, or anyone who has been helpful. Keep it short and real.
Certificate Most courses require certificates that are signed by the guide verifying the originality.
Abstract A concise description of your project, highlighting objectives, methodological aspects, as well as conclusions.
Introduction: Explain the background of your topic, goals and research queries.
Literature Review: Review the current research or studies that relate to your subject.
Methodology Explain how you gathered data, sampling size, tools utilized and techniques for analysis.
Evaluation and Discourse Discuss your findings clearly. Use tables, charts, or graphs when necessary.
Conclusion and recommendations Summary: To conclude your study, point out the major findings, and suggest practical implications.
References: List all sources which are referenced in the proper format.
Appendices Include survey questions, raw data, or additional material.
Following this format will ensure you do not miss any crucial section.
Step 5: Writing the Project
The next step is writing. Keep in mind that clarity and simplicity are more important than fancy words. IGNOU evaluaters prefer clear and well-organized content over long sentences.
Tips for writing with ease:
Write in short paragraphs and with clear headings.
Avoid filler or jargon that isn't needed. content.
Explain tables or charts instead of copying them.
Use examples to help clarify difficult concepts.

Step 6: Reviewing and Editing
Once your initial draft is completed, don't rush into an application. Editing is critical. Review your project for:
Spelling and grammar mistakes.
Formatting consistency.
Quality and clarity of content.
Reliability of information and references.
It's helpful to read the piece aloud and ask for a person to look over it. Sometimes, small mistakes become obvious if the text is read out loud.
